private static void DumpDatabaseData()
 {
     using (var context = new VehicleStoreContext())
     {
         var branchesWithRevenues = context.Branches.Include(b => b.Revenues);
         foreach (var branch in branchesWithRevenues)
         {
             Console.WriteLine(branch);
         }
     }
 }
 private static void SaveDataIntoDatabase(IEnumerable <BranchEntity> data)
 {
     using (var context = new VehicleStoreContext())
     {
         foreach (var branch in data)
         {
             context.Branches.Add(branch);
         }
         context.SaveChanges();
     }
 }
        private static void ClearDatabase()
        {
            using (var context = new VehicleStoreContext())
            {
                var deleteRevenuesSql = $"DELETE FROM {MonthlyRevenueEntity.TableName}";
                context.Database.ExecuteSqlCommand(deleteRevenuesSql);

                var deleteBranchesSql = $"DELETE FROM {BranchEntity.TableName}";
                context.Database.ExecuteSqlCommand(deleteBranchesSql);
            }
        }